Attari is last point in India on a journey from Delhi to Lahore. The village of Attari is named after the gallent defender of Sikh Kingdom of Lahore. His name was S. Sham Singh. And this small town is known Attari Sham Singh

When I visited Attari on May 21, 2008, I noticed a lot  of restoration activity by a contrator of Govt of Punjab. The tomb and large historic tank of Sham Singh was being restored. It was a matter of great relief that Punjab Govt was doing something to restore heritage. Though the department didn't touch palace of S. Sham Singh.It is estimated the palace will crumble any day within 10-15 years. It has been the dubious policy of Govt not to encourage survival of ramnants of Sikh raj.

About 20 km from Amritsar on Lopoke-Chogawan Road is the shrine of Baba Jago at  village Kohali where he laid down his life for the dignity of Sikhism during the reign of Guru Hargobind sahib.

At the basement of Baba Jogo Shaheed is the original tomb.

About 50 kms is the village Khalra on indo-pak border. There lies a gurdwara which commemorates the visit of Guru Nanak to this place. Majestic court of Guru  Hargobind sahib ji where Chandu sahi is being produced. V Nanak was martyred by emperor Jahangir due to backbitings of Chandu. This painting is at display at village Sidhwan near Khalra. Bhai Jetha the vallient saint solder of Guru produced Chandu. Guru awarded Jetha with a rosary.

15 km from Amritsar at village Mehma  is the shrine dedicated to martyr Didar Singh who laid down his life defending Sikhs along with Baba Deep Singh Shaheed.
